How Do We Teach Children – “Why there are no nuns @ St. Peter’s Church?”

(As seen in the bulletin January 27, 2019)

While women religious used to serve as teachers in our school, that hasn’t been the case for a good number of years due to the decline in numbers of women religious along with advanced average ages.  However, we are blessed with Sr. Janet Heder SSSF in our community; as retired religious she was caretaker for her brother while helping with school art classes and projects; she now lectors, helps as a  rosary leader, participates in group bible and book studies as well as sewing for the missions.  Sr. Margaret Held OSF grew up in Slinger, went to school here, and was murdered while serving a poor county as a mission worker in the southern USA; she was truly saintly.  There are several young women from the parish in the process of actively associating themselves in the religious life and communities: Sr. M. Faustina (former Rachel Yank) associated with the Schoenstaat Sisters of Mary in Waukesha since 2010 and is nearing her final promises; Sr. Alena Marie (former Megan Carl) is in her 2nd year of novitiate and hopefully will take first vows as a Missionary of Charity in December this year.
